Untrue, the reason why AW can survive so well on perilous is the due to the fact he can take a hail of arrows without promoting constitution stats up the Wazoo. Strength of spirits makes him even stronger against enemy dmg now with the patch. As long as barrier is generated through fade cloak/cl in a mob he is practically invincible. There's a reason why he is the most plays character because of his survivability against all factions compared to say rogues who are weapon and promotion dependent.

He shouldn't be nerfed, in the games current state there isn't any justification to mitigate his barrier generating abilities without reducing his dmg from abilities like fade cloak and frost step thus effect all mage classes indirectly. but a lot of pugs have that competitive mindset due to the post game scores. It's already alienated a lot of players not because of the character per se but rather warriors not being able to maintain adequate guard at higher difficulties.

For balance and appeasement sake as to not alienate more of the small damp community, Bioware could look into adding medals/bonus points like dmg soaking, number of downs/revives into the scoreboard because right now it doesn't take into account those Intangibles that make a team get through a successful extraction.
